Output c0b66bf79a63e4cb84001c3f2461705ec671a4ebe61ba8deeaeeba6f236d96d5:17

value
37859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01a6c5222c486d0d6ec0afae82eb4100e97ad05 OP_EQUAL
address
3N7xwRbeAkdrGufHs7kK2XYzbZTXBn7zBN
transaction
c0b66bf79a63e4cb84001c3f2461705ec671a4ebe61ba8deeaeeba6f236d96d5
confirmations
83771
spent
true